1 Star 0 Fork 0

xinban/Python的内置函数

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
文件
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
自省.py 835 Bytes
一键复制 编辑 原始数据 按行查看 历史
xinban 提交于 2021-09-14 17:14 . test
import inspect
'''
自省(introspection),在计算机编程领域里,
是指在运行时来判断一个对象的类型的能力。它是 Python 的强项之一。
Python 中所有一切都是一个对象,而且我们可以仔细勘察那些对象
Python 还包含了许多内置函数和模块来帮助我们。
'''
print(inspect.getmembers(str)) # 查看一个对象的成员getmembers()方法,inspect模块包含获取对象信息的函数
print('-'*10,"分割线","-"*10)
# 我们运行 dir() 而不传入参数,那么它会返回当前作用域的所有名字
print(dir(str)) #它返回一个列表,列出了一个对象所拥有的属性和方法
print(type('')) # type 函数返回一个对象的类型
print(type([])) # <class 'list'>
a = 'ss'
print(id(a)) # id() 函数返回任意不同种类对象的唯一ID
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
1
https://gitee.com/qitu1024/built-in-functions-of-python.git
[email protected]:qitu1024/built-in-functions-of-python.git
qitu1024
built-in-functions-of-python
Python的内置函数
master

搜索帮助